From patchwork Mon Jun 26 21:46:20 2023 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Sakib Sajal X-Patchwork-Id: 26438 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from aws-us-west-2-korg-lkml-1.web.codeaurora.org (localhost.localdomain [127.0.0.1]) by smtp.lore.kernel.org (Postfix) with ESMTP id 3F6A1EB64DC for ; Mon, 26 Jun 2023 21:46:48 +0000 (UTC) Received: from mx0b-0064b401.pphosted.com (mx0b-0064b401.pphosted.com [205.220.178.238]) by mx.groups.io with SMTP id smtpd.web10.4828.1687816006281395437 for ; Mon, 26 Jun 2023 14:46:46 -0700 Authentication-Results: mx.groups.io; dkim=pass header.i=@windriver.com header.s=pps06212021 header.b=nydBPr11; spf=permerror, err=parse error for token &{10 18 %{ir}.%{v}.%{d}.spf.has.pphosted.com}: invalid domain name (domain: windriver.com, ip: 205.220.178.238, mailfrom: prvs=5541c98b54=sakib.sajal@windriver.com) Received: from pps.filterd (m0250812.ppops.net [127.0.0.1]) by mx0a-0064b401.pphosted.com (8.17.1.22/8.17.1.22) with ESMTP id 35QLTlRL004305 for ; Mon, 26 Jun 2023 21:46:45 GMT D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=windriver.com; h=from:to:subject:date:message-id:content-transfer-encoding :content-type:mime-version; s=PPS06212021; bh=iidIinHjKHQZ3ERBde JV2FLjns8IjBPVrS1jdG5Hzig=; b=nydBPr11mwLAIB7XzO5FFjIWUPD3/AXd/E 3JJBW4XWkg50HceKuquvzYlBFmrBC3fiVS6RqueVNlhPnZ/4uGD89JxjN2A/K+FK Fm1jD5P6W3W2a62ON8DNj4sMgGj577kYQxdcaNXLA5C9IUaemiePAmWyed0LCAMj +Pw7u6RqYPnvpwDIVspY1bKA2SjsyOpA0e9llThWitpgATLqpxoycBOHQRlkQeOQ +3Mu6c1ZZwTjeHv90kRDAYG8xdBmL1Y2acNe4C5cZTlTuWLXWPvNHFdC7jb9HqMH pI+Xtlgg6PJMO9bie/nhhQfj6eQZ5TnupmWrWNvUAXgWpp4K4Vtg== Received: from nam12-bn8-obe.outbound.protection.outlook.com (mail-bn8nam12lp2168.outbound.protection.outlook.com [104.47.55.168]) by mx0a-0064b401.pphosted.com (PPS) with ESMTPS id 3rdqf4a5et-1 (version=TLSv1.2 cipher=ECDHE-RSA-AES256-GCM-SHA384 bits=256 verify=NOT) for ; Mon, 26 Jun 2023 21:46:45 +0000 (GMT) ARC-Seal: i=1; a=rsa-sha256; s=arcselector9901; d=microsoft.com; cv=none; b=I8IWdxn9JxiGW59vkFT6uxIX8P4f17D/QAisdQbLgl1M2TmvBKTpLc4mYdXgy6mKMxNKzGrcPzyx3+SC3eCYhyt5dW+39x0uQK3X2tFLLnvKYfyjRMrTEadSTux4X3Ux8rnOIvjITlWnmg3IMDAUX5yyhafemap/2gj6I1t5dgJqboIcjLAW0LS3YhRss4qlRnXf/WjparwCwoiBHzrH/uNkcTHr8nilc5pRPK0jBVjfy4HWx7jN8avpQCqfOQsqBSIyRKOretQG9xEU60fpmD1K5CGRvwmm+W0DsXczMG8zlPd538fQxGVfqRD2lT6OUrK62ZH8fsCQ8piWzV0WqQ==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ector9901;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-AntiSpam-MessageData-ChunkCount:X-MS-Exchange-AntiSpam-MessageData-0:X-MS-Exchange-AntiSpam-MessageData-1; bh=iidIinHjKHQZ3ERBdeJV2FLjns8IjBPVrS1jdG5Hzig=; b=cUOKZzr0N2bUlf3mmZ6Ux3Ngk3qgmj3UE1PSrl+K1p4Zb+70vtLvlYWiZsYI0y04ICIbIgXCFGW9rUOtNdcZaf5SvernbB5X/xZ0KuE14XmXVnCdW1HW1+3gAL0zlCcLvq1e9EOzeUVx+N7Y9YTmMR9DnYyLuOjSKplMdGz6rTHfot/+sRI0lY9Z93Tf1BgAFqYGhV3WTqDO49fu9j9k1cvLfq+Tw73VzCR8Mn10hhNVAz+dr2DD3aSfIIEVFJQ4ewxB4XgwrIVmrtEZOF0tyIdKxILeJnSpplqwjtwT1LQtvQF/FUGLOWLz8ii3M2JrxK1RIuCUZ30DWvsvA6n0wg== ARC-Authentication-Results: i=1; mx.microsoft.com 1; spf=pass smtp.mailfrom=windriver.com; dmarc=pass action=none header.from=windriver.com; dkim=pass header.d=windriver.com; arc=none Received: from DM6PR11MB2538.namprd11.prod.outlook.com (2603:10b6:5:be::20) by CO1PR11MB5041.namprd11.prod.outlook.com (2603:10b6:303:90::16)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.6521.21; Mon, 26 Jun 2023 21:46:41 +0000 Received: from DM6PR11MB2538.namprd11.prod.outlook.com ([fe80::8dd:d4cb:2602:c41]) by DM6PR11MB2538.namprd11.prod.outlook.com ([fe80::8dd:d4cb:2602:c41%4]) with mapi id 15.20.6521.026; Mon, 26 Jun 2023 21:46:41 +0000 From: Sakib Sajal To: openembedded-core@lists.openembedded.org Subject: [PATCH] bno_plot.py, btt_plot.py: Ask for python3 specifically Date: Mon, 26 Jun 2023 17:46:20 -0400 Message-Id: <20230626214620.121199-1-sakib.sajal@windriver.com> X-Mailer: git-send-email 2.40.0 X-ClientProxiedBy: MN2PR19CA0063.namprd19.prod.outlook.com (2603:10b6:208:19b::40) To DM6PR11MB2538.namprd11.prod.outlook.com (2603:10b6:5:be::20) MIME-Version: 1.0 X-MS-PublicTrafficType: Email X-MS-TrafficTypeDiagnostic: DM6PR11MB2538:EE_|CO1PR11MB5041:EE_ X-MS-Office365-Filtering-Correlation-Id: 1ebb6493-26d5-4389-b828-08db768ed375 X-MS-Exchange-SenderADCheck: 1 X-MS-Exchange-AntiSpam-Relay: 0 X-Microsoft-Antispam: BCL:0; X-Microsoft-Antispam-Message-Info: a+KPdHBclqMPmFvAd9rnrQcHcOqZJV8a7Rh+tEI0lonXEfYJRCN0Qe2MoFpv0VIfyAOY6nQGArOfC740FvgCX5/Q0ZcjnOeVlSMKVZsvXanDJkcFeHXoC0ib6kWfU8fcTsW2Qe+6TFiQKyWDWjD2xLSd/zF8keaqe01ex52DPY9dD8In3vcNlVKzE6L1PW7KQV8CPXfCy0egn5JrbSFJQyhLykTq3dW1T24D6kAcXNuRtxXro+5DWY0FlRyHRfqW9wLfLrzteZ/GF/JNELww10cfPgWZal/A5ia2XZ48ItzZ2Rd83MObLkQYD6RsQFzIgZaydaAxHGPv5LnYCDjZ+cH3SIO00gXh26zysRQlY+jRZehn5ICcO5KizjkTBXthhhVaxsUDsOgHUkax4dv9nUlKGTQeX2gyw/UcMVquZFqGiTwt5CmxkcqHWzelALjq7DhwuPqEMcdVskymUJXqRWLfDCBQ56SG5wHS+Gfw1kt+0EjEAN1rbCEKZhb231SPznIzfdkgr3tbJp0dfz9MbBafNHmMRB53QpdIhp2TSn5IPUSPRUpeJbppFjEiDnSYJ2+jtmuQouRcAP+ku8tc9x9ZzU3HZSFUyN0LuUjrMAA= X-Forefront-Antispam-Report: CIP:255.255.255.255;CTRY:;LANG:en;SCL:1;SRV:;IPV:NLI;SFV:NSPM;H:DM6PR11MB2538.namprd11.prod.outlook.com;PTR:;CAT:NONE;SFS:(13230028)(4636009)(376002)(136003)(366004)(396003)(346002)(39850400004)(451199021)(83380400001)(316002)(8936002)(6486002)(6666004)(52116002)(8676002)(41300700001)(36756003)(86362001)(38100700002)(38350700002)(44832011)(2616005)(5660300002)(66946007)(66556008)(66476007)(6916009)(2906002)(478600001)(26005)(6512007)(186003)(1076003)(6506007);DIR:OUT;SFP:1101; X-MS-Exchange-AntiSpam-MessageData-ChunkCount: 1 X-MS-Exchange-AntiSpam-MessageData-0: z3t5fNV3nG7STJ5RQn0q/sIPu/7hAzmKNGiSrYq4krJ3orCwx1XVLNjHn5IfH++CclD9xr2iGrRYG6Z5z6ArYyrbr0fAyowh8CTU1Hlp8xxgmj1C8wUgR54/69PsPTPZkxTMCHj9mxZ5xmRLLvxW0GU6k/Yrfg205cwCWCr0sf1oJW049lYNFH3K4Ec+XOvJX0TK7SS1MM5R1hzu35i0iptapRoQbKi8eoqKXV7GJg9sBWY5zEbK+7GNpv1roUAcqXQ5i0/AvDyyetqEgWoR79peoZaCwJjHJxkqjQ3BI3PWRbtjH4b//vWwpS+SRP0geCLSQCmBmBmqMsUCV1q762gRYi0t0yY7S60o5npgUMhSvLr1OiFT3oS6aTkuhzmRA+p3clBWDyyLJiFxSnNRB9XO7qX6IyIpIXymzlXMfmE2yuhVoK728dY0N4oxwjKeuJmFHWEC60W0A2KvTF/lPNnm8RIPHn02WDsM9OLzhFiCYWA3yWMHDgjXNT144pxHHMc06nW/H1H2mQFpztI4weAc8uqdVWge2+9eTp6q38AO51fAHtVMvS1HraHlMkrDIAPau5uOWS48NudPJn9kLcw3yytmuujBmx+ytXg1Ui0EnMnDQBYHn+ivj52i26Zo2olBXqly/Pvm3ia2Qj4WNrJbx1sgu7OIPi7DCER+yMcRjjVGSWxI1jaEAiteMcOqiIcnT/AAVSR/5K1XxUiNCoI9jmPokXns+nLbSTzr3ps3kUylUxR7F7c16cwfVYmzKEdBYLlVtDxmlcJDzhg91efs8UdtwYHafY3fZKOIZ9l5Bq7+BF+iw4dQtzrMCifcX00+W3ffxHSOV7F9te7tzE7GCtRj6rKTo02MvBD7+CTwjivlhyxmGkHApgcZRMBuulAooOSwzxf4UqufZEb6KFtynD43elNjA1MWwGtPYFQY6meZV5P7ns0UvUufhpPNQvqmS2bnbZLW8dBDNsIKtUZN/o5/9wQ0mGtoPxDiTT8AjCBtO9p9TAMBoUEMvl8Uhppq3NyVj7nOe1mSQ2epvEblEUeKnti6jyvIgVgVdoHbfrqbD+1tQZVYmb1Z19aY6Jn9ODyMklDILUkU14zM9kyrC+OerL0ADLZ2yqdx43aLEMtmhop9r+ffBlrmXco7BRY65vYEzSKNNLL0DNqthb9Rfu3iVV/C/KUDXeR1tDZNj5lxtylCVfr2BBRdDb0SXKtnlsM+DmIMtCn30xPnmjYG7SqkQCcJl/HZq5ApOPWFoP5rIU3hhpxMHyaCMBBWemPSP6M9l6t9y4SIzwpP+LKdHezFNAq/7j8xhhrxFqecNGSQ+cVrJE4CI1p6djl/rpLrWG+4qeBVJ/d8rM1tJAhSQK5fXS+CwjY4WnXTgwYtJJ9QZaGl9Vw4Jpuf1x8bNQdzhe4GPZeXvmHCmGU+dcG1m2iBZjIGHPiPPiBbrkoh6b6xMoK99aUvmBpHDYJuWjYJHWfhlD0yKFEce21K+L7erW7Wkha89gcAc0Em6QuBbOPPnJ7NDiofpNgdJhHs8hNvMbK4ot6vXHzcoCUDCDPLqHloXMDekkSlPCCHWyNoMIhD80wzZuVTkG79KdPEAA6UhMge1lxHh3ENEmVEoQ== X-OriginatorOrg: windriver.com X-MS-Exchange-CrossTenant-Network-Message-Id: 1ebb6493-26d5-4389-b828-08db768ed375 X-MS-Exchange-CrossTenant-AuthSource: DM6PR11MB2538.namprd11.prod.outlook.com X-MS-Exchange-CrossTenant-AuthAs: Internal X-MS-Exchange-CrossTenant-OriginalArrivalTime: 26 Jun 2023 21:46:40.9635 (UTC) X-MS-Exchange-CrossTenant-FromEntityHeader: Hosted X-MS-Exchange-CrossTenant-Id: 8ddb2873-a1ad-4a18-ae4e-4644631433be X-MS-Exchange-CrossTenant-MailboxType: HOSTED X-MS-Exchange-CrossTenant-UserPrincipalName: mf3p9V3l5oW7KBnPcSe/D24Wr/Mg3HPkD6bEW0Wd3wgZkIIEPP3M/zL7RnoipaIzzl905UU14fSNLUciX97zEFhGm4GR51Cvd37Ou46qifY= X-MS-Exchange-Transport-CrossTenantHeadersStamped: CO1PR11MB5041 X-Proofpoint-ORIG-GUID: T-sDfk343YFAwr75wtc01aSVzs8ppElH X-Proofpoint-GUID: T-sDfk343YFAwr75wtc01aSVzs8ppElH X-Proofpoint-Virus-Version: vendor=baseguard engine=ICAP:2.0.254,Aquarius:18.0.957,Hydra:6.0.591,FMLib:17.11.176.26 definitions=2023-06-26_18,2023-06-26_03,2023-05-22_02 X-Proofpoint-Spam-Details: rule=outbound_notspam policy=outbound score=0 spamscore=0 adultscore=0 phishscore=0 clxscore=1011 mlxlogscore=498 lowpriorityscore=0 malwarescore=0 mlxscore=0 suspectscore=0 bulkscore=0 priorityscore=1501 impostorscore=0 classifier=spam adjust=0 reason=mlx scancount=1 engine=8.19.0-2305260000 definitions=main-2306260202 List-Id: X-Webhook-Received: from li982-79.members.linode.com [45.33.32.79] by aws-us-west-2-korg-lkml-1.web.codeaurora.org with HTTPS for ; Mon, 26 Jun 2023 21:46:48 -0000 X-Groupsio-URL: https://lists.openembedded.org/g/openembedded-core/message/183431 python2 has been deprecated, use python3 instead Signed-off-by: Sakib Sajal --- ...plot.py-Ask-for-python3-specifically.patch | 35 +++++++++++++++++++ meta/recipes-kernel/blktrace/blktrace_git.bb | 4 ++- 2 files changed, 38 insertions(+), 1 deletion(-) create mode 100644 meta/recipes-kernel/blktrace/blktrace/0001-bno_plot.py-btt_plot.py-Ask-for-python3-specifically.patch diff --git a/meta/recipes-kernel/blktrace/blktrace/0001-bno_plot.py-btt_plot.py-Ask-for-python3-specifically.patch b/meta/recipes-kernel/blktrace/blktrace/0001-bno_plot.py-btt_plot.py-Ask-for-python3-specifically.patch new file mode 100644 index 0000000000..a3b8a98589 --- /dev/null +++ b/meta/recipes-kernel/blktrace/blktrace/0001-bno_plot.py-btt_plot.py-Ask-for-python3-specifically.patch @@ -0,0 +1,35 @@ +From b8d9618cbbec5a04cf6dede0a6ceda41021b92ae Mon Sep 17 00:00:00 2001 +From: Sakib Sajal +Date: Mon, 26 Jun 2023 17:34:01 -0400 +Subject: [PATCH] bno_plot.py, btt_plot.py: Ask for python3 specifically + +python2 is deprecated, use python3. + +Upstream-Status: Denied [https://www.spinics.net/lists/linux-btrace/msg01364.html] + +Signed-off-by: Sakib Sajal +--- + btt/bno_plot.py | 2 +- + btt/btt_plot.py | 2 +- + 2 files changed, 2 insertions(+), 2 deletions(-) + +diff --git a/btt/bno_plot.py b/btt/bno_plot.py +index 3aa4e19..d7d7159 100644 +--- a/btt/bno_plot.py ++++ b/btt/bno_plot.py +@@ -1,4 +1,4 @@ +-#! /usr/bin/env python ++#! /usr/bin/env python3 + # + # btt blkno plotting interface + # +diff --git a/btt/btt_plot.py b/btt/btt_plot.py +index 40bc71f..8620d31 100755 +--- a/btt/btt_plot.py ++++ b/btt/btt_plot.py +@@ -1,4 +1,4 @@ +-#! /usr/bin/env python ++#! /usr/bin/env python3 + # + # btt_plot.py: Generate matplotlib plots for BTT generate data files + # diff --git a/meta/recipes-kernel/blktrace/blktrace_git.bb b/meta/recipes-kernel/blktrace/blktrace_git.bb index d0eeba3208..288784236a 100644 --- a/meta/recipes-kernel/blktrace/blktrace_git.bb +++ b/meta/recipes-kernel/blktrace/blktrace_git.bb @@ -14,7 +14,9 @@ SRCREV = "366d30b9cdb20345c5d064af850d686da79b89eb" PV = "1.3.0+git${SRCPV}" -SRC_URI = "git://git.kernel.dk/blktrace.git;branch=master;protocol=https" +SRC_URI = "git://git.kernel.dk/blktrace.git;branch=master;protocol=https \ + file://0001-bno_plot.py-btt_plot.py-Ask-for-python3-specifically.patch \ + " S = "${WORKDIR}/git"